Technical Specifications
| Manufacturer |
Intel |
| Model Number |
BX8071512400F |
| Type |
6-Core Desktop Processor |
| Base Clock |
2.50 GHz |
| Max Boost Clock |
4.40 GHz |
| Cores/Threads |
6 cores / 12 threads (with Hyper-Threading) |
| Cache |
18MB Intel Smart Cache |
| Socket |
LGA 1700 |
| Memory Support |
DDR4-3200, DDR5-4800 |
| Integrated Graphics |
None (F-series - requires a discrete GPU) |
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Does the Intel i5-12400F support Hyper-Threading Technology?
A: Yes, this 6-core processor features 12 threads thanks to Intel's Hyper-Threading Technology, enabling better multitasking performance for gaming while streaming, content creation, and productivity applications.
Q: What type of integrated graphics does this processor have?
A: The i5-12400F is an F-series processor with no integrated graphics. This design reduces cost while requiring a dedicated graphics card, making it ideal for gaming builds with discrete GPUs.
Q: Is this processor suitable for overclocking?
A: The i5-12400F has a locked multiplier and cannot be overclocked. However, it delivers excellent performance at stock speeds with boost clocks up to 4.40 GHz, making it perfect for reliable gaming performance.
